How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aromas?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Aromas Studio Apartments | $1,768 | $1,689 | $1,824 |
Aromas 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,133 | $1,650 | $2,685 |
Aromas 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,761 | $1,970 | $5,641 |
Aromas 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,048 | $2,270 | $3,650 |
Aromas 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,814 | $3,371 | $4,700 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Aromas Apartments with Washer/Dryer
How much is the average rent for Aromas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Aromas with Washer/Dryer is $2,536.
What is the largest Aromas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Aromas is a 1,310 square feet unit starting from $1,928 at Pointe at Harden Ranch.
What is the average size for Aromas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Aromas is currently at 677 sq ft.
